Episode 127: AHOCT- Pre-Chalcedonian Christology

A History of Christian Theology - Un podcast de Chad Kim

In this episode, Tom, Trevor, and Chad return to the format of earlier podcasts and discuss a few texts from early Christian thinkers. In this case, we are talking about Apollinaris of Laodicea and Theodore of Mopsuestia. They represent early christological thinking from an Alexandrian and Antiochene point of view.
